@@Jeremy9697They live mainly in cold desert areas, in the mountains between 2700 meters and 4500 meters, where the snow cover is lower than 20cm, but can tolerate +30c and down to -50c. You do know that Antarctica is a desert also, yeah (largest on Earth)? A desert isnt classified as a hot area.

You left out how much they absolutely hate socializing and affection they are not people friendly, but they are gorgeous and are supposed to smell like the freshest air.
In addition to all those negatives they have poor immune systems. They do well in their native environment but they couldn't handle an environment that's less hostile to bacteria, viruses, etc.
